Amazon’s high costs eat into profits

April 28, 2014

Internet retailer Amazon reported a 32% rise in profits to $108m (£64m) in the first quarter of 2014, but expenses rose 23% on last year.

Global social media ad trends: Facebook and LinkedIn grow as Twitter dips

April 24, 2014

Facebook’s ad business has continued to grow with click through rate (CTR) and ad impressions increasing by double-digits quarter-over-quarter, at 20% and 41% respectively, according to new research looking into global social media ad trends.
